"textContent": "Frost Giant Studios says it will patch Stormgate so it can be played offline, but its online modes will be gone at the end of April.",
"title": "Stormgate, the StarCraft-like RTS that launched last summer, is losing online multiplayer support because its server partner was bought by an AI company",
